Broad Street Run: They expect about 20K runners this year.

Course: A 10-mile, point-to-point course (named one of the fastest 10-mile courses in the country by Runner's World) starts at the Central High School Athletic Field at Broad Street and Somerville Avenue. The course is a pleasing run past the varied neighborhoods of Philadelphia along Broad Street. It finishes inside the Philadelphia Navy Yard at the end of Broad Street in South Philadelphia. There are eleven water stations, digital clocks at each Mile, aid stations, port-a-potties, entertainment and numerous ambulances on the course. The course is traffic-free in the south-bound lanes and monitored by police. This course is certified by USATF.

I'm doing the Broad Street Run on Sunday.  It's my second time.  Did it last year.  The one thing that really surprised us last year is how cold it was prior to the race.   Bring some throw away sweats and ditch them at the starting line. 

This is a great race.  The first five to six miles down to City Hall is a gradual downhill or flat.  The rest is just flat.  The weather looks like we might be in for rain. 

There are mobs of people, bands, frats, sororities out there cheering you on.  Just enjoy the race.  Don't get too caught up in the start and burn out trying to go at someone else's pace. 

I'm also in the purple corral (8xxx?).  Make sure you arrange a meeting place at the end because it is packed.
